Bartender Salary in Birmingham, AL
Based on current listings, the average salary for a Bartender in Birmingham, AL is $31,100 per year or $15 per hour, reflecting compensation typical of full-time positions.
Salaries typically range from $18,700 per year up to $52,000 per year depending on experience, venue, and shift schedules.
Lowest wage for Bartenders in Birmingham | Average wage for Bartenders in Birmingham | Highest wage for Bartenders in Birmingham |
---|---|---|
$18,700 per year | $31,100 per year or $15 per hour | $52,000 per year |
Upscale bars and popular nightclubs often offer higher wages and better tipping potential.

What To Expect as a Bartender in Birmingham
Bartenders in Birmingham are generally responsible for:
- Mixing and serving beverages promptly and professionally
- Operating POS and cash register systems
- Maintaining clean and organized bar stations
- Engaging customers and upselling premium drinks
Many venues expect Bartenders to manage inventory and comply with local alcohol service laws.
The role often requires flexibility to work nights, weekends, and holidays, especially in busy nightlife areas.
While some employers prefer experience, many offer on-the-job training for motivated candidates.
